What is the meaning of the name Gwynivere ?

The baby name Gwynivere is a Female name , 3 syllables long and is pronounced GWIN-ə-VEER (IPA: /ˈɡwɪnəvɪər/).

Gwynivere is Welsh in Origin.

Gwynivere is a contemporary English respelling of Guinevere, the legendary name of King Arthur’s queen. Rooted in Welsh Gwenhwyfar (gwen “white, fair, blessed” + hwyfar “phantom, spirit; smooth”), it carries senses such as “white/fairest spirit,” “blessed phantom,” or “the fair one.” The initial 'Gwyn-' echoes Welsh gwyn “white, blessed,” reinforcing the luminous meaning while giving a modern, Welsh-flavored twist.

The name spread through medieval romance, notably in Geoffrey of Monmouth’s Latinized chronicles, the 13th‑century French Vulgate Cycle, Malory’s Le Morte Darthur, and later Victorian poetry, cementing it as an emblem of courtly love and tragic passion. Variants include Guinevere, Guenevere, Gwenevere, Guenever, and the Welsh original Gwenhwyfar; related international forms are Ginevra (Italian) and Ginebra (Spanish). Jennifer, via Cornish Jenefer, is a later cognate. Gwynivere itself remains rare, appealing to parents seeking a distinctive mythic classic.
